As mentioned above, BetterLinks is an all-in-one link management plugin with so many features. To get the ‘Instant Elementor Redirects’ feature, navigate to BetterLinks dashboard → Settings → General Settings. Then toggle to enable the way to redirect links within Elementor. 

redirect links within Elementor

Now time to open the page you want to redirect by clicking ‘Edit with Elementor’ button. The page will be instantly open in Elementor. Now go to the page settings by clicking the ’Gear’ icon from the down bar. After that, navigate to the ‘BetterLinks Instant Redirect’ feature and enable it as shown below.

redirect links within Elementor

Instantly after that, all the options related to link redirection will be available from the Elementor editor. You can set the Target URL, your link redirection Type, and also link options like sponsored, do follow, no follow, etc. You can also enable the tracking of the URL directly from Elementor panel. 

redirect links within Elementor

After configuring all, click on the ‘Update’ button and all the changes will be saved. That’s it. This is now seamlessly you can redirect links within Elementor without any hassle.

The Importance Of Measuring Affiliate Marketing Metrics

Tracking essential metrics for your affiliate marketing campaigns will help you analyze the overall success of your business strategies and programs. They also help you establish important strategies to help your business achieve short and long-term objectives. It helps to identify areas where you should refocus your efforts and highlight which actions you should prioritize to improve your company’s success.

  1. Click Traffic

We start off our list of the top 10 affiliate marketing metrics with the one that’s sometimes considered the most important to track – the Click Traffic. The number of clicks from affiliate links, over a certain period of time, usually shows the level of exposure the products are receiving among the affiliates’ promotional channels and is a direct indicator of conversion rates. 

Well, in simpler words, you can compare the number of traffic/clicks from a particular campaign to the number of sales that actually takes place from those clicks to determine how successfully the affiliate marketing campaigns are actually running. A very high number of clicks driving only a small number of sales, or even no sales, then it can be an indicator that your campaign strategy is just not working. 

Tracking the Click Traffic metric lets you understand exactly how well and which aspects of your marketing campaign are working. It’s important to collect information about the clicks you’re receiving from the affiliate links or ads – where the leads are coming from, if they are bouncing, or if they are taking the time to convert to paying customers. You can also take a more in-depth look at this affiliate marketing metric to identify which websites, affiliates, or platforms are sending the most traffic, and then narrow down the most profitable channels for your company and growing revenue.

  1. Conversion Rates

Then, on our list, we have one of the most important Affiliate marketing metrics that you must follow, regardless of how large or small your business is, and that is the Conversion Rate. It is simply a percentage determining the ratio of the number of your site visitors who become paying customers as compared to the number of people who just click on the affiliate links but never convert. From the Click Traffic metric, you will be able to understand if your campaigns are being noticed or not, but this is the metric that helps you understand how many of those clicks typically drive a single conversion.

Now it is also important to understand that conversion does not only relate to sales, conversion can mean a lot of different things based on your personal aims for your brand. You might be trying to get new website visitors or customers to sign up for your loyalty program, or simply sign up for your email newsletter. Either way, as long as the traffic incoming to your website is successfully converting, your conversion rate will go up.

Affiliate marketing metrics

What you can do is regularly monitor this metric to keep track of how well your campaigns are being conducted. But you also need to keep a special eye out for the times when there is a special promotion or sales program running on your website because it will give you a clear indication of how well it resonated with your target audiences. For instance, you might want to check the change in conversion rate after running a special promotion to understand how well it resonated with your audience.

  1. Average Order Value 

Just looking at affiliate marketing KPIs like the overall number of conversions isn’t enough. Even if your total sales this year aren’t as big as last year’s, you could still make more money if your average order value is higher. So, then, we have the Average Order Value (AOV) metric which helps to determine the amount of money or price that your customers spend on your products during a single visit. It’s an essential metric when it comes to determining marketing effectiveness and the profitability of your programs or affiliates. This feature directly relates to the total amount of profit or revenue that your website is making from its users.

  1. Gross Orders vs Net Orders

This time, the affiliate marketing metric is a little different as we will be looking at the difference between your gross orders and net orders. As the name might suggest, the Gross orders refer to the total number of sales generated by your affiliate program, while the Net orders refer to the number of totals minus all the voided orders due to return or cancellation.

Let us make it simpler for everyone to understand: 

Gross Orders = Simply the total number of orders your affiliate campaign brings

Net Orders = Gross Orders (Total) – the number of returned or canceled orders

This is an important measure to monitor because a high number of gross orders but a much lower number of net orders could indicate a problem elsewhere. You might be able to spot concerns like fraud, logistical failure, and a lack of quality control, among others. Otherwise, it could be an indication of affiliate fraud, in which a partner uses deceptive methods to place a large number of orders in order to increase their commission and take more money from you.

  1. Return On Investment (ROI)

This one is perhaps the most important metric that your need to track for your affiliate marketing program as Return on Investment (ROI) indicates if your spending on the campaign is yielding a positive, negative, or break-even result.

After you’ve covered your program’s fees, this is the revenue you generate from your affiliate program (i.e., affiliate commissions, the cost of affiliate program software or an affiliate network, the salary of an affiliate manager, if you have one).

Simply subtract the program costs for a specific time from the revenue generated during that period to calculate ROI. You may also divide the total earnings from the affiliate program by the cost to see how much money you get back for every dollar you spend. You’ve broken even if your result is a dollar because a dollar spent equals a dollar earned.

  1. Top Affiliates

Following the idea of finding out which affiliates bring you the most sales and conversion, another important affiliate marketing metric that you need to track is Top Affiliates. Make it a habit to record your top 10 most active affiliates who contribute to driving the maximum amount of revenue to your program each year. And then, of course, make sure to keep a healthy and strong partnership with them for the long term. 

Affiliate marketing metrics

But how can you easily track who your top affiliates are? Well, the best way to track this affiliate marketing metric is by assigning a unique UTM code to each of the affiliates taking part in your program, and providing them with a unique affiliate marketing URL. Then you can use advanced link management tools to track that particular UTM code or link to see who brings you the most traffic and sales. 

This affiliate marketing measure is extremely valuable for keeping track of which affiliates you should use to boost your marketing program’s earnings. It can also help you spot any performance dips among your normally high-performing affiliates and take the necessary steps to get your sales back on track.

  1. Affiliate Contribution Margin

The revenue generated by an affiliate minus the expense of recruiting that certain affiliate is the contribution margin. This metric can be calculated for each individual affiliate, as an average of all your affiliates, or a combination of the two. If an affiliate brings in a repeat customer, it accounts for the recurring revenue they are accountable for, too. The contribution margin can be thought of as the average “lifetime value” of affiliates too and is similar to CLV.

Adding links to YouTube video descriptions is a constant way to show clickable links. While you have video-related blogs, documentation, etc. to your video, you can easily mention them. Also, for branding purposes, you can mention the landing page link, product page link, support link, and so on. The most important thing is, you can add as many links as you want in a YouTube video description. 

You have to add links on YouTube video descriptions while publishing or scheduling the video to publish. To do that, click on the ‘Create’ button from the studio and upload the video. Instantly a popup will appear. From there in the Details section, you can add clickable links for your YouTube video. Then click on the ‘Next’ button and provide all other details. 

add links on YouTube

Another way to add links on YouTube video descriptions is after publishing the video. From the YouTube Studio, you can add clickable links on videos any time you want and modify them. Don’t forget to save changes after modification. Also, need to mention that, you can add links in description on YouTube for free, no need to join the YouTube Partner Program

Cards are the best way for cross-promotion strategy in your YouTube videos. You can add other channels or your channel’s names, videos, or links to the cards. To add links on YouTube cards, you have to join the YouTube Partner program. Unless the option to add links won’t show to you. 

You have to add links to your YouTube video from Video Elements section. After giving the video details, this section will appear. Select Cards from there. 

add links on YouTube

Now, add the links on your YouTube video. You can add multiple clickable links in multiple time lengths of your video. Here is the preview of how to add links on cards. 

add links on YouTube

To add links on YouTube video end screen, you have to join YouTube Partner program as well. Without it, the option to add links to your end screen won’t come. In the same process from the Video Elements section, you have to choose End Screen and add clickable links there. Also need to keep in mind, you have to keep the end screen for more than 5 seconds to add links. 

add links on YouTube

Adding clickable links in YouTube video comments is one of the popular strategies to increase engagement in the comment section. Moreover, the link doesn’t go away in the middle or beginning of the YouTube video. A comment box is a constant place, so viewers can redirect to that mention anytime they want. In addition, you can pin your comment, so that it will appear at the top of the comment section.

To add links to YouTube video comments, go to one of your published YouTube videos. Then in the comment section add links and click on the ‘Comment’ button. That’s it. 

add links on YouTube

Suppose, you don’t have access to add links on YouTube cards or the end screen. That means you can’t add links in the middle of the video. In this kind of scenario, you can still add links via QR code. First, generate the QR code of the link you want to add to your video, then add the screen on the video while editing. After that, your audience can easily redirect to the given link by scanning the QR code.
